Arnold American Legion Post 684 is an American Legion veterans post located in Arnold, Pennsylvania. Founded as part of the American Legion network established in 1919, this post carries forward a century-long tradition of service to veterans and their communities.

Membership in the American Legion is open to veterans who served at least one day of active military duty during eligible wartime periods and were honorably discharged. Family members may join the American Legion Auxiliary or Sons of the American Legion.
